Early Life and Education
Nigella Lawson was born on January 6, 1960, in Wandsworth, London. She comes from a distinguished family; her father was a prominent politician and her mother an heiress. Lawson attended the prestigious St. Anne’s College, Oxford, where she studied Medieval and Modern Languages. This academic foundation played a crucial role in shaping her articulate communication style, which has become one of her hallmarks as a food writer and television personality.

Career Highlights: A Culinary Icon
Nigella’s career began as a food journalist, where she honed her skills in writing and presentation. She gained fame with her first cookbook, “How to Eat”, published in 1998, which sold over 300,000 copies in the UK alone. This success was followed by her television debut in the series “Nigella Bites”, which aired from 1999 to 2001 on Channel 4. Television Shows and Their Impact
Nigella’s television career expanded with shows like “Nigella Feasts”, “Nigella Express”, and “Simply Nigella”. These programs not only highlight her cooking techniques but also her philosophy of enjoying food as part of a fulfilling life. Through her relaxed approach to cooking, Lawson encourages viewers to embrace the process rather than focus solely on perfection.
Personal Life: Relationships and Family
Nigella Lawson has experienced significant highs and lows in her personal life. She was married to journalist John Diamond in 1992, with whom she had two children, Cosima and Bruno.
